iPhone can be used as an iKey to your Home?

by iPhone Observer

According to Daily Record, Apple has filed for an interesting patent. Presumably named iKey, the technology would replace a ring of keys with only one iPhone. The device could be used to dial a PIN which will in turn allow yourself to enter a protected space: a home or a car. Of course, the home and the car should have installed compatible locks.

The interesting thing about using this type of device is that will make the iPhone a much more close tool than just a phone. Opening your house or car door is a matter of security and it usually gives you a completely different emotional response than just a simple communication. As strange as it may seem, this patent could push Apple into a very promising area: the intelligent home.

The patent will be similar with what car manufacturers are using right now and it’s based on a technology called Near Field Communication, which allows electronic devices to transmit information between each other when close together.

But then again, it could just be a dead end, since Apple has filed a lot of patents in the past which led nowhere. But, to be honest, this type of intentions is what makes me look at the iPhone, iPad and the whole Apple thing extremely careful :-) .
